> > 192.168.100.20, -, -, N, 13/02/99, 05:28:25, 1, -, -, 195.63.104.45, -,
> > 80, 45054, 381, 73, http, -, -, http://195.63.104.45/images/logout.gif, -,
> > Cache, 10060
>
> LOGFORMAT (%S, %u, -, N, %d/%m/%y, %h:%n:%j, 1, -, -, %f, -, %j, %j, %j, %b,
> %j, -, -, %r, -, %j, %j, %j)
>
> I only get a handful of corrupt lines using the above. I'm still not 100%
> convinced I've got the total Bytes transferred correct (the totals seem low
> from a 20Mb logfile).
>
It looks like you've got the %b too late. Shouldn't it be the 45054 not
the 73 in the above example? So you would have ... %f, -, %j, %b, %j, %j, ...
or something like that.
Also, I don't think what you've called %f is actually %f. I think it's
probably %v.
